Mane & Mo have made me better
CAOIMHIN KELLEHER has thanked Liverpool’s world-class attack for taking his game “to another level”.
But he joked that his confidence is often shot trying to keep Mo Salah, Sadio Mane and Roberto Firmino at bay in training.
And Kelleher - Ireland No.2 behind Darren Randolph - believes they can fire the defending champions back into the title mix.
The goalkeeper, who faced Brighton last night, singled out Salah as the toughest to keep under wraps in training but laughed: “I hate facing all the strikers, my confidence is getting killed every time!
“But it’s the best training I could possibly get, facing the best three attackers in the world.
“It takes your game to another level, it’s class. They’re exactly the same in training as they are in games - so in sync and in tune with each other.”
Kelleher, 22, made his Premier League and Champions League debuts this season but hasn’t featured since the FA Cup win at Aston Villa.
Yet he has now established himself as the preferred second-choice behind Alisson.
“It was a dream come true when I heard I was playing in the Champions League, I couldn’t believe it,” recalled the Cork man of December’s clashes with Ajax and Midtjylland.
“Stepping out on the pitch and hearing the Champions League music, I couldn’t describe the feeling.
“But I’m a chilled guy on and off the pitch. The way I am off the pitch transcends onto it and helps me make the right decisions in games.”
